    In 2006, 3 Faculty workgroups were formed based on the interests of OISSE Faculty Associates. In these workgroups, faculty work collaboratively to meet targeted needs. 
    • Professional Formation
      Facilitator—Teresa Cochran
      Focused on Ignatian-based values
      Development of Professional indentity among health sciences students
    • Health Promotion
      Facilitator—Ann Ryan Haddad & Marlene Wilken
      Work with underserved populations and address health disparities
      Develop infrastructure to support community engagement
    • International Outreach
      Facilitator—Caroline Goulet
      Collaborate to develop international outreach

    The Office of Interprofessional Scholarship, Service and Education (OISSE) focuses on supporting faculty interested in interprofessional community engagement. Faculty across the health sciences can join OISSE as a Faculty Associate. Faculty Associates are fulltime faculty with a vested interest in developing and implementing community engagement and collaborative scholarship with a focus on underserved populations or groups  aligned with Creighton’s mission. Learn more about becoming a OISSE Faculty Associate.
